Output 63887d821d9ad056ec43c0a1a7ae802498059997c1530f54b02b66713ba4564a:5

value
269942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a9675986a99b621428f0b5bffa9d429f91bc050 OP_EQUAL
address
3BQbnydTURWRjiMUH7n775SQtKBWpdvuSS
transaction
63887d821d9ad056ec43c0a1a7ae802498059997c1530f54b02b66713ba4564a
spent
true